Yemen Hezbollah calls on Muslims to participate in jihad to defend Palestine and the surrounding region from zionist assaults

The leader of Yemen's Ansarullah movement has urged Muslim countries to unite and participate in jihad against perceived adversaries, highlighting a lack of alternatives amidst American-Israeli strategies targeting their subjugation.

In a televised address from Sana’a on Thursday, Houthi asserted that if Arab and Muslim communities had adopted a Qur’anic and faith-driven strategy towards jihad, they might have successfully defended Palestinian lands and safeguarded the region against Israeli influence.

The leader of Ansarullah criticized what he termed as ineffective gestures and insubstantial gatherings, along with the declarations from Arab and Muslim leaders in support of Gaza, labeling them as “futile.”

He emphasized the importance of sincere, faith-motivated actions to free individuals from fears and to empower the Muslim community to address challenges with efficacy.

A Houthi spokesperson commended the sacrifices made by martyrs in the defense of Islamic values, alleging that both Washington and the Tel Aviv administration are determined to exert control over the entire region.

He stated that the United States must be held accountable for its involvement in the crimes allegedly committed by Zionists over the past decades in regions including Palestine, Lebanon, Syria, Jordan, and Egypt.

The leader of Ansarullah alleged that the United Kingdom and France collaborated with the United States in facilitating the settlement and support of Zionist groups on Palestinian territories, including their recruitment, arming, and empowerment.

He emphasized the necessity for Muslim nations to extend their support to the resistance movements in Gaza, Lebanon, and other affected regions.

Militant groups in Gaza remain resolute, delivering significant blows to Israeli forces. Meanwhile, Hezbollah is making notable advances and demonstrating resilience against the escalating aggression in Lebanon.

Houthi has called on Muslim nations to align themselves with the right course by extending their support to fighters in Palestine, Lebanon, Iraq, and Yemen.

The leader of Ansarullah criticized assertions made by proponents of Zionism regarding freedom, human rights, and civilization, describing these statements as misleading and deceptive.

He highlighted the tumultuous histories of the Americans, British, French, and Germans, asserting that their past actions have resulted in the loss of millions of lives through highly violent means.

The Houthi movement has emphasized that the United States’ use of its veto power in the United Nations Security Council to block a ceasefire resolution in Gaza underscores what they perceive as Washington’s aggressive and hostile stance towards Arab and Muslim communities.

The Houthi movement has issued a nationwide call to all sectors of Yemeni society, urging them to join large-scale demonstrations on Friday in a show of solidarity with the Palestinian and Lebanese peoples.
